Getting Started with your Yerba Mate Sample
To try the loose leaf yerba you will need a bombilla which is a straw with a filter at one end, usually made from metal. Loose leaf yerba is typically drunk from a “mate” a type of cup. The most traditional type is the natural gourd, although there are other cups made of glass, wood and ceramic available too. The way yerba is prepared is by filling the cup to around 3/4 full and adding a little water to allow the leaves to swell inside. The bombilla is then inserted into the mate cup and hot water is added. The resulting brew is subsequently sipped through the bombilla. This last step is then repeated over and over. Traditionally, mate is enjoyed in groups and the mate is passed around in a “round” system. This is why mate is such an important social tradition in South America.

The yerba mate tea bags are just like any normal teabag. The way to prepare it is to add hot water to the teabag in a mug and then allow to brew. Normal brewing time is 2-3 minutes but this can be increased or decreased according to your taste.
